CHIEF ORTHOPAEDIC TRAUMA TECHNOLOGIST

Job Group M
Job Requirements

For appointment to this grade, a candidate must:

i.          Served in the grade of Senior Orthopaedics Trauma Technologist for a minimum period of three (3) years

ii.        Diploma in Orthopaedics plaster Technology from recognized institution

iii.      Certificate in Management Course lasting not less than two (2) weeks from a recognized institution

iv.       Certificate in Computer application skills from recognized institution

v.         Shown merit and ability as reflected in work performance and results. 

Job Description

Duties and Responsibilities

i.          Interpreting radiological images of orthopaedic and trauma cases; Supervising the manipulation and reduction of fractures and dislocations

ii.        Supervising the fixing and removal of cast, bandages and traction's to and from patients; managing the correction of congenital Talipes Equino-Varus (C.T.E.V.)

iii.      Ensuring documentation of orthopaedic and trauma cases; assessing and referring patients with Musculo-skeletal conditions; managing minor orthopaedic and trauma cases in emergencies and accidents

iv.       Sensitizing and creating awareness on orthopaedic trauma conditions to the communities and initiating research on orthopaedic and trauma techniques and trends

v.         Providing orthopaedic and trauma assistance during orthopaedic surgical operations; Carrying out minor orthopaedic operative techniques involving insertion and removal of steinman’s pins and skull calipers; removing External fixators

vi.       Ensuring collection and compiling of orthopaedic and trauma reports; conducting follow-ups of orthopaedic and trauma cases in the wards and out-patient clinics; collecting and collating data relating to orthopaedic and trauma conditions; counselling patients/clients on cases regarding orthopaedic trauma; and coaching and mentoring health trainees in orthopaedic and trauma.
